Abstract

A new type of self-consolidating concrete (SCC), semi-flowable SCC (SFSCC), has been developed for slip-form paving construction. Several field applications of the SFSCC have been conducted. Based on the research results, guidelines for SFSCC mix design, testing, production and construction are developed. This paper provides an overview of the guidelines. In this paper, SFSCC mix design methodology, quality control test methods and special requirements for paving equipment and operations as well as post-placement techniques are presented.
